5 km from Batutumonga, on the road to Pangalla, just before the village of Loko'Mata, stands a monumental boulder over 20 metres in diameter, with some sixty mausoleums carved directly into the rock. Impressive, especially when you see the fragile but ingenious bamboo structures used to excavate and access the upper chambers. The richly decorated tombs display photos of the deceased, flowers (even plastic ones), bottles and many other objects. The Toraja believe that these offerings help souls to pass on to the afterlife. Some mausoleums bear witness to the age of the place.
